  • AGAVE GYPSOPHILA ‘IVORY CURLS’. Info

    Latin Name: Agave Gypsophila ‘Ivory Curls’

    Common Name: Variegated Gypsum Century Plant. ‘Ivory Curls’ Gypsum Century Plant. ‘Ivory Curls’ Century Plant.

    Native to: Australia.

    Hardiness: Frost tender but and extremely drought tolerant.

    Growth: Succulent. Rosette of undulating bluish-grey fleshy leaves, with broad ivory cream marginal stripes. Soft spines leaf edges with smallish terminal spine.  Grows up to 2-3ft tall and wide. Slow growing.

    Sun: Sun/Partial shade.

    Exposure: Sheltered.

    Soil: Well drained, plenty of gravel.

    Moisture: Water very little. Dry in winter.

    Agave Gypsophila ‘Ivory Curls’.
    The Agave Gypsophila ‘Ivory Curls’ is a smaller growing variety of Agave and difficult to find in production. Easy to grow but slow, it is one of the most stunning and pretty agaves. Fleshy undulating, wavy leaves are arranged in usually a solitary open rosette, being bluish-grey in colour with a striking broad ivory cream margin. Small soft marginal spines and terminal spine are also present.
    Great for exotic gardens, it’s bold silhouette makes a wonderful architectural addition but it also makes a stunning pot plant.
